Digital Communications Manager

The American Association for Justice (AAJ) works to preserve the constitutional right to trial by jury and to make sure people have a fair chance to seek justice when they are injured by the negligence or misconduct of others—even when it means taking on the most powerful corporations.

Digital Communications Manager Responsibilities

  • Work with Communications Team to develop and implement online communications strategy, including generating content, maintaining content calendar, managing social media accounts, and executing digital campaigns.
  • Lead coordinated digital communications efforts across internal departments, external stakeholders, and organizational partners.
  • Create, edit, and manage original content, including copy, graphics, and videos for AAJ and the Take Justice Back campaign.
  • Work with Communications Team and AAJ Leadership to develop social media and digital best practices.
  • Build social media following and engagement through organic and paid growth.
  • Monitor civil justice news and trends across a variety of platforms. Work with Communications Team to develop and execute rapid response strategies.
  • Assist with building lists of key influencers, stakeholders, partners, and media and manage clips database of relevant stories.
  • Propose new initiatives and ideas in strategy sessions and daily communications planning meetings.
  • Other duties as assigned.

Qualifications

Requirements:

  • Minimum of three years of digital communications experience.
  • Creative, hardworking, and committed to promoting and strengthening civil justice.
  • Self-starter who thrives in a fast-paced atmosphere.
  • Strong writing skills, attention to detail and good judgment.
  • Ability to work independently and under deadlines for multiple concurrent projects.
  • Understanding and knowledge of social media best practices, trends, and analytics.
  • Experience in media, political campaigns, Hill offices, or public relations preferred.
  • Experience with graphic design and video editing software, such as (but not limited to): Canva, Adobe Photoshop, Adobe Premier Pro, Illustrator and InDesign; working knowledge of Sitecore and WordPress or other web content management system preferred.
  • Occasional travel for semi-regular conferences and events.
